What is recorded here
This stone commemorative plaque records: John Sell Cotman 1782-1842 One of the most famous of the Norwich School of Painters Lived in this house
John Sell Cotman was a prominent British watercolorist and engraver, renowned for his contributions to the Norwich School of painters; he is remembered for his innovative landscapes and marine paintings that captured the essence of East Anglia.
